Following the success of the R107, the R129 Mercedes-Benz SL had a tough act to follow, as it still had to carry on the tradition of a fast and reliable grand touring convertible. A special edition R129 was built in 1995 to commemorate Stirling Moss’ historic 1955 Mille Miglia road race win. Moss and Jenkinson achieved the all-time record average speed for this race and ahead of rival Juan Manuel Fangio.The special R129 Mille Miglia was available as an SL320 or SL500 and only available in Brilliant Silver Metallic, equipped with Evo II six-spoke polished alloys and a Red and Black leather interior complemented by carbon-fibre trim. The side fender grilles were also given a rather unique chequered flag treatment.

Understood to be one of just 40 right-hand drive examples made, this example displays just c.56,500 miles from new and with just 4 former keepers recorded on the V5C has been in current ownership since 2021. When the vendor purchased 'JOF 216', it was then subject to new discs, new pads, new Michelin tyres, new Bosch fuel pump, new belt and hoses, new plugs and new oil and filter. The air-conditioning does require attention. The cherished registration 'JOF 216' is included in the sale plus a hardtop, along with the owner's wallet, the handbook, stamped service book, a collection of old MOTs and invoices plus the V5C Registration Document.
